Course Curriculum Overview:
The course curriculum is extremely relevant and to the point. The curriculum is not as heavy as the ones you'd see in other universities know for law, like Christ but just as effective with only the required amount of workload on students. The curriculum and the professors take an interest in the real world scenarios and real world examples are almost always used along with concepts for the better understanding of students. As of now as a first year law student, i dont see significant ways the curriculum and teaching methods can be improved, they work just fine. The frequency of exams are less as it is in the hands of the professors to conduct the mid terms as they wish and most professors prefer a time where the students do not have burdens from other subjects and are able to give their all. And a few professors even give graded assignments as substitution for mid term examinations.
